About the crossing

The Rådhusbrygge 3–Dronningen ferry

Rådhusbrygge 3 to Dronningen is a scheduled Oslo og Akershus ferry crossing. The sea distance is roughly 1 nautical miles. The service runs every day.

Bygdøyfergen operates this crossing; the crossing takes about 13 min; 27 sailings run on a typical operating day; the first departure is around 09:10 and the last around 17:50.
